Esmertec Buys CoreTek Systems Mobile

February 3rd, 2005

DUEBENDORF, Zurich-Embedded software company Esmertec, which sells Java virtual machine technology to mobile-phone makers, announced it will purchase the mobile division of Chinese technology company CoreTek Systems. Terms of the deal were not disclosed.
Esmertec said the move would boost its presence in the region and increase sales. The company previously set up a customer support center in both Taiwan and Korea and took a majority stake in its Japanese technology partner eValley.

CoreTek develops and markets a series of mobile software and tools, such as its J2ME test suites, DeltaMMS MMS development and management software, DeltaBrowser – a dual WAP and Web browser.
